Boundary Element Analysis of Buckling Analysis of Plates and Shells
摘要
This chapter presents a methodology based on the Boundary Element Method for buckling analysis of shear deformables plates and shells. This formulation is based on the plate and shell equations presented in previous chapters. The buckling equations are established from the initial deflection calculation, and the generalized forces acting on the plate are calculated in the linear elastic problem. Thus, the buckling problem is established as a standard eigenvalue and eigenvector problem by reorganizing the plate equations.
